Abstract
The invention relates to the field of movie and television shooting, in particular to a movable supporting device for movie and television shooting, which comprises a base, wherein a movable supporting mechanism is arranged on the lower side of the base, a damping mechanism is arranged on the upper side of the base, a first electric telescopic mechanism is arranged on the damping mechanism, a clamping mechanism is arranged at the upper end of the first electric telescopic mechanism, the clamping mechanism comprises a rotating motor, a rotating plate is arranged at the output end of the rotating motor, a clamping seat is arranged on the right side of the rotating plate, a clamping cavity is formed in the outer side of the clamping seat, second electric telescopic mechanisms are arranged on the four walls in the clamping cavity, a clamping plate is arranged at the outer end of the second electric telescopic rod, and a protective pad is arranged on the outer side of the clamping. The structure setting of this device can satisfy different shooting demands as required, guarantees the efficiency of shooting and the quality of shooting, and the practicality is strong.

Technical Field
The invention relates to the field of film and television shooting, in particular to a movable supporting device for film and television shooting.
Background
The film and television uses copy, tape, film, memory, etc. as carrier, and uses screen and screen projection as purpose, so that it can implement visual and auditory comprehensive ornamental artistic form, and is a comprehensive form of modern art, including film, TV play, program and animation, etc.

As a still further scheme of the invention: the damping mechanism comprises a damping seat, a damping cavity is formed in the damping seat, a damping pad is arranged in the damping cavity, a damping column is arranged in the middle of the damping pad, and the first telescopic mechanism is installed at the upper end of the damping column.
As a still further scheme of the invention: a plurality of cavities are formed in the shock pad, and shock absorption springs are arranged in the cavities.
As a still further scheme of the invention: and an equipment cavity is formed in the lower side of the base, and the walking supporting mechanism is installed in the equipment cavity.
As a still further scheme of the invention: the walking support mechanism comprises a third electric telescopic mechanism installed in the equipment cavity, a turnover motor is installed at the lower end of the third electric telescopic mechanism, a turnover plate is arranged between the turnover motors, a plurality of supporting legs are arranged on the lower side of the turnover plate, and universal wheels are arranged at the lower ends of the supporting legs.
